How to Cleanse Crystals: Every Method Explained Simply

Crystals are not passive objects. They interact with the energy around them, absorbing, transmitting, and holding what they encounter. Cleansing is the practice of clearing accumulated energy from a stone so it can return to its natural state, ready to be worked with intentionally again. How often you cleanse depends on how frequently you use a stone and in what context: crystals used for emotional processing need more regular clearing than those sitting quietly on a shelf. Most practitioners cleanse at least once a month, often at the new or full moon.

When to do it

Any time, but the new moon and full moon are traditional cleansing points that many practitioners find natural rhythms to work with. New moon for releasing old energy, full moon for charging and refreshing.

Moonlight

Leave your crystals on a windowsill or outside overnight during a full or new moon. This is the gentlest and most universally safe method, suitable for virtually every stone including water-sensitive ones. Even on a cloudy night, the moon's energy is present.

Sunlight

A few hours in morning sunlight will cleanse many stones, but be cautious. Amethyst, rose quartz, fluorite, celestite, and other colour-sensitive stones will fade in direct sun. Use this method only for clear quartz, hematite, carnelian, and naturally dark or white stones.

Running water

Hold the stone under cool running water (a tap is fine) for one to two minutes while visualising the water carrying away accumulated energy. Safe for hard, non-porous stones like quartz, jasper, obsidian, and agate. Do NOT use water on selenite, angelite, celestite, lepidolite, kyanite, malachite, or any stone with a Mohs hardness below 5. When in doubt, use a dry method.

Smoke cleansing

Pass your crystal slowly through the smoke of sage, palo santo, cedar, or incense for twenty to thirty seconds. Safe for all stones, including water-sensitive ones. Visualise the smoke drawing out and carrying away any energy that does not belong to the stone.

Sound

Use a singing bowl, tuning fork, or bell near your crystals. The vibration from sound moves through the stone and displaces stagnant energy. Effective and completely safe for all stones, including fragile ones. Ideal for a whole collection at once.

Selenite or kyanite charging plate

Place your crystals on a slab of selenite or alongside a piece of kyanite overnight. Both minerals are self-clearing and believed to transmit a cleansing vibration to whatever rests against them. A low-maintenance method ideal for daily or ongoing clearing.

Earth burial

Bury a crystal in the earth (your garden, a pot of soil) for 24 hours to one week. The earth will draw out and neutralise accumulated energy and naturally recharge the stone. Mark the spot so you can find it again. Best for dense, grounding stones like black tourmaline, hematite, and obsidian.
